  • Junior sf Gabby Williams finished with a triple double (16 pts, 16 reb, 10 ast) in UConn 94th straight win over East Carolina.That was the 5th triple-double in Huskies history, last one by Kiah Stokes vs same school two years ago.

    Williams is a tremendous athlete who also starred in track & field at hs, competing in high jump and 100/300 m hurdles. At 15 she was the youngest competitor at the US Olympic Track & Field Trials in high jump.

    • Despite 44 pts of national leading scorer Kelsey Plum, Washington was edged by Stanford in the last quarter, losing 72-68. Whilst Plum moved to the third place in career scoring (just behind Brittney Griner and Jackie Stiles) Cardinals coach Tara VanDerveer reached her 999th win.

      Triple double of Alexis Jones in Baylor rout of Oklahoma 92-58. The senior guard finished with 24 points, 12 rebounds and 10 assists, becoming only the second Lady Bear to achieve the record, besides Brittney Griner (who did it five times).

      • Reaching 1000 career wins, Tara VanDerveer is preceeded just by Mike Krzyzewski (1060) and the late Pat Summit (1089) in NCAA Div.I history.

        • Soph Bridget Carleton led unranked Iowa State to an upset road win over #22 West Virginia 80-55, scoring 31 pts. Carleton is a former star of various Canadian cadet/junior national teams.

          Junior guard Kelsey Mitchell finished with 32 points in Ohio State rout of Wisconsin 96-68. Mitchell, who leads the Buckeyes with 23.2 ppg, hit 11 of 13 shots, including 6 of 8 threes.

          • Leading UConn to an easy 96-49 win over Cincinnati with 24 points, Napheesa Collier was perfect in shooting (10/10 FG, including 1/1 three, and 3/3 FT). The all-purpose soph forward also finished with 12 rebounds, 6 assists and 5 blocks. Huskies recorded their 98th straight win.

            • Soph Asia Durr scored her second straight 30+ points game as Louisville downed Virginia Tech 88-70. Durr made four 3-pointers, her 30th consecutive game with at least one three. She currently leads Cardinals in scoring with nearly 18 ppg.

                • UConn extended its win streak to 100, beating South Carolina 66-55. Huskies were led by a super Gabby Williams (career high 26 points, 14 rebounds 4 assists and 4 steals).
                  Kia Nurse and Williams have played in every game of the streak.

                  • Kelsey Plum moved to the 2nd place of NCAA all-time scoring list leading Washington over USC with 35 points. She is now 78 points shy of Jackie Stiles record of 3393 pts.

                    • Big game of big Kalani Brown who led Baylor to a narrow win over Texas 70-67. The sophomore center scored 35 points on 10/12 FG shooting and grabbed 13 rebounds. Baylor played most of the game without its leading scorer senior Alexis Jones, who left early with a knee injury.

                      • Many expected Kelsey Plum to set new all-time scoring record by the end of season, but nobody thought so early. Washington's senior guard exploded for 57 points in yesterday win over Utah and with her 54th point she surpassed Jackie Stiles previous record.

                        • Career-high for soph Napheesa Collier, who scored 39 pts (15/19 FG shooting) and grabbed 12 rebounds in UConn rout of South Florida, 96-68. UConn finshed the regular season and extended its win streak to 104.

                              • Katie Lou Samuelson scored 40 points and UConn easily won the ACC title smashing South Florida 100-44. Husky super soph hit an amzing 10 for 10 from beyond the arc, a Div.I record, and was also perfect from the FT line (6/6) but was just 2/4 on 2-pt FG.

                                Unranked West Virginia scored a major upset shocking Baylor 77-66 for the Big 12 title game, behind 32 points of Tynice Martin. The soph guard set a new record for conference championship final, previously held by Brittney Griner with 31.
